When I, Robot was filmed, it was captured using Super 35mm film. Super 35 captures a native 4:3 or near-16:9 square-ish frame. For the theatrical release, director Alex Proyas and cinematographer Simon Duggan matted (cropped) the top and bottom of the frame to achieve a cinematic . An Open Matte version unmasks those cropped areas.
